Lenfest Institute for Journalism announces $400K Beyond Print grant program
The Lenfest Institute for Journalism has launched a $400K grant program called Beyond Print, aimed at supporting independent local newspapers in transitioning to digital sustainability. The program includes grants of up to $50K per organization and offers additional services like a Community of Practice and expert network advisory services.

Newspaper Media Group earns grants from Lenfest Institute for ...
This article reports on the Lenfest Institute for Journalism's inaugural Philadelphia Local News Sustainability Initiative, which awarded $2 million in grants to 17 local news organizations in the Philadelphia region. The article provides details on one of the grantees, Newspaper Media Group, which will receive $100,000 to support digital innovation, language translation services, and new reader revenue strategies. Inside the Lenfest-OpenAI-Microsoft partnership: One-on-one with Jim ...
This source covers the Lenfest Institute's $10 million AI Collaborative and Fellowship program, a partnership with OpenAI and Microsoft targeting major U.S. metro newsrooms. CEO Jim Friedlich discusses the initiative's philosophy: AI as a sustainability tool rather than journalist replacement. The program places fellows in five newsrooms (Chicago Public Media, Minnesota Star Tribune, Newsday, Philadelphia Inquirer, Seattle Times) with three more planned.
